Tiaan Pretorius: A Rising Star in Canadian Cricket

Tiaan Pretorius was born on December 22, 2000, in Pretoria, South Africa, into a family with a deep appreciation for sports. Growing up in a nation renowned for its rich cricketing history, Tiaan was exposed to the game from an early age. His early life in South Africa laid the groundwork for what would become a remarkable cricketing journey.

Early Life and Development

Tiaan displayed an affinity for cricket as a child, often participating in local matches and youth leagues. The vibrant cricketing culture of South Africa helped him hone his skills, from a young age playing with tennis balls on dusty streets to competing in organized youth tournaments. His talent was evident in his quick reflexes and a natural ability to read the game. He began playing at local clubs and caught the attention of regional selectors, eventually representing his province in youth cricket.

In pursuit of broader opportunities, Tiaan's family moved to Canada, where his cricketing journey would take an unexpected but thrilling turn. The move presented Tiaan with the chance to make a significant impact on the emerging cricket scene in Canada, a country where the game was steadily growing in popularity.

Professional Debut and Progression

Making his professional debut for Canada in 2019, Tiaan quickly showcased his potential as a talented all-rounder: a right-handed batsman and a right-arm off-spinner. His adaptability and hard work paid dividends as he gradually established himself in the national setup. He made his List A debut against the United States in the 2018 Americas Qualifier, scoring an impressive 85 runs. This performance was a sign of his growing maturity as a cricketer and a precursor to future successes.

Key Milestones and Achievements

One of Tiaan’s significant early milestones came just a few months after his debut when he was selected for the Canadian squad in the ICC T20 World Cup Americas Qualifier in 2019. In this tournament, he played several vital innings and took crucial wickets that helped propel Canada through the competition. His performance was instrumental in qualifying for the ICC T20 World Cup Qualifiers, a huge accomplishment for Canadian cricket.

In 2021, Pretorius further cemented his status as one of Canada’s promising cricketers by being a critical player in the team during the ICC Americas regional tournaments. His ability to perform under pressure against established teams showcased not only his technical skills but also his mental toughness. Tiaan’s standout performance brought him into the spotlight, raising expectations for the young player.
